About the Role

We are beginning a major project to update our collection of print books and journals in the Hartley Library.  We are looking for people who are confident in understanding and using data. This role will help determine decisions and deliver results for our project.  The project is expected to run for 24 months and the posts are full-time (up to 36 hours per week) and fixed term for that period. 

You will be part of our Collections Development team. The team work to improve the quality of our print collections and how our students, staff and visitors are able to access those collections. You will need:

  • To be familiar with our new collections policy and able to apply this
  • To be able to analyse and interpret data and feedback on our collections and how they are, or are not, being used. 
  • To be willing to contribute to workflows and processes to shape and apply best practice to our stock management processes
  • The ability to interact with colleagues in other teams.
